Vegan Green Goddess Dip
This vegan Green Goddess Dip is creamy, tangy, vibrant, and bursting with fresh herbs. It's makes a delicious snack paired with raw veggies, crackers, or even potato chips! It takes just minutes to whip up and can easily be doubled.

- 1 avocado peel and pit removed
- ½ cup unsweetened, plain dairy-free yogurt
- ¼ cup fresh chopped parsley
- ¼ cup fresh chopped cilantro
- ¼ cup fresh chopped basil
- ¼ cup fresh chopped dill
- 2 green onions sliced
- 2 cloves garlic
- 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
- ½ teaspoon salt or to taste
Add all ingredients to a food processor.
Blend until creamy, stopping to scrape down the sides as necessary to ensure all ingredients are fully incorporated.
~ Use FRESH herbs! Do not use dried herbs for this green goddess dip.
~ Roughly chop the fresh herbs before adding them to the food processor to ensure they get fully incorporated.
~ If your dip is too thick, add a tablespoon or two of water and re-blend. Alternately, you can add extra lemon juice or yogurt if you need a bit more tang, too.
~ If your dip is too thin, add extra avocado or use it as a dressing instead of a dip.
~ Always taste and adjust seasoning to your liking!
